Transaction c527ed594870f31f05f3cc592162495fad31e95dca16a622147203a7510a1fa2
1 Input
2 Outputs
- c527ed594870f31f05f3cc592162495fad31e95dca16a622147203a7510a1fa2:0
- c527ed594870f31f05f3cc592162495fad31e95dca16a622147203a7510a1fa2:1
value 27194560
address 326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h
value 43984179
address 18QLuGUUffKtHmZPWwgNQeP1rqGmi8XQrY